From de9fbf4c2cfcad376955ad3faaff0f4eab101e93 Mon Sep 17 00:00:00 2001 From: Bartosz Taudul Date: Wed, 20 Sep 2017 00:53:39 +0200 Subject: [PATCH] Check if window is not under another window. --- server/TracyView.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/server/TracyView.cpp b/server/TracyView.cpp index 08bb160c..4f9a73e8 100755 --- a/server/TracyView.cpp +++ b/server/TracyView.cpp @@ -453,7 +453,7 @@ void View::DrawFrames() auto draw = ImGui::GetWindowDrawList(); draw->AddRectFilled( wpos, wpos + ImVec2( w, Height ), 0x33FFFFFF ); - bool hover = ImGui::IsMouseHoveringRect( wpos, wpos + ImVec2( w, 60 ) ); + bool hover = ImGui::IsWindowHovered() && ImGui::IsMouseHoveringRect( wpos, wpos + ImVec2( w, 60 ) ); const auto wheel = io.MouseWheel; const auto prevScale = m_frameScale; if( hover )